Caucus: New Jersey | Episode | Nurse Practitioners in the New World of Health Care

A Nurse Practitioner is a nurse with a graduate degree in advanced practice nursing. Nurse Practitioners can take a patient’s history, perform medical exams, order lab tests, and, in states like NJ, they can even prescribe medication. Currently with 4,000 Nurse Practitioners in the state and the ACA approaching in 2014, they are expected to make a big impact on the new world of healthcare.
